Frequently asked questions
What federal contracts does iCatalyst, Inc hold?
iCatalyst, Inc (UEI LZP7BJ41G7L5) shows $24.3M across 26 award actions in SCOUT’s public USASpending-backed profile, with Department of Transportation (DOT) as the top buying agency. Totals cover federal prime awards ≥$100K in the rolling window.
How much in federal contracts does iCatalyst, Inc have?
iCatalyst, Inc shows $24.3M across 26 award actions. SCOUT tracks 6 incumbent recompetes ($18.7M) returning to market in the next 24 months.
Which agencies does iCatalyst, Inc work with?
iCatalyst, Inc’s firm-wide obligated mix is led by Department of Transportation (DOT) (69%), Department of Education (ED) (31%).
What is the UEI for iCatalyst, Inc?
The Unique Entity ID (UEI) for iCatalyst, Inc is LZP7BJ41G7L5.
